1. Screen Mirroring

Screen mirroring is one of the simplest methods to project your phone’s display onto your TV. This can often be done wirelessly, and it supports various devices.

How to Set Up Screen Mirroring

Here’s a step-by-step guide for both Android and iOS users:

For Android Users:
  1. Connect Your TV and Phone to the Same Wi-Fi Network: Ensure both your TV and phone are on the same local network.
  2. Open the Screen Mirroring Feature: Access your phone’s settings and look for “Screen Mirroring,” “Smart View,” or “Cast,” depending on your Android device.
  3. Select Your TV: Choose your TV from the list of available devices.
  4. Start Mirroring: Once connected, your TV should display your phone’s screen, allowing you to navigate games and apps seamlessly.
For iOS Users:
  1. Connect to the Same Wi-Fi Network: Just like with Android, ensure both devices are connected to the same network.
  2. Access the Control Center: Swipe down from the upper right corner on iPhone X and later, or swipe up from the bottom on earlier models.
  3. Select Screen Mirroring: Tap on “Screen Mirroring” and select your Apple TV or compatible device.
  4. Start Playing: Your iPhone screen should be mirrored to the TV right away!

2. Using HDMI Cables

For those who prefer a wired connection, using an HDMI cable is a reliable option that provides the best image quality with minimal lag.

Required Equipment

  • An HDMI cable
  • An adapter to connect your phone to the HDMI cable (if necessary; certain phones have USB-C or Lightning ports).

Steps to Connect Your Phone Using HDMI

  1. Connect the Adapter: Plug the HDMI adapter into your phone.
  2. Connect to the TV: Connect the HDMI cable to the adapter on one end and to a free HDMI port on your TV on the other end.
  3. Select the Source: On your TV remote, switch to the input channel where the HDMI cable is connected.
  4. Launch Your Game: Your phone screen, including games, apps, and other media, will be displayed on the TV.

3. Using Streaming Devices

Streaming devices like Chromecast, Amazon Fire Stick, or Apple TV offer a more advanced experience. They support various screen-casting features and even integrate specific gaming apps.

Setting Up a Streaming Device

  1. Set Up the Device: Install and connect the streaming device to your TV and set it up on the same Wi-Fi network.
  2. Install the Required Apps: Download and install any required applications for casting.
  3. Cast Your Game: Open the corresponding app on your phone (like Google Home or Apple TV), select your streaming device, and choose “Cast Screen” to enjoy your game on the big screen.

4. Bluetooth Controllers

For a more authentic gaming experience, consider using a Bluetooth controller. Many newer games support Bluetooth controllers for mobile play, which can enhance gameplay.

Connecting a Bluetooth Controller

  1. Put Your Controller in Pairing Mode: Refer to the controller’s instructions for this step.
  2. Open Bluetooth Settings on Your Phone: Go to Settings > Bluetooth, and make sure Bluetooth is turned on.
  3. Connect the Controller: Find the controller in the list of available devices and select it to pair.
  4. Start Gaming: Once paired, you can launch any supported game and use the controller to play.

Pitfalls and Considerations

Before diving into mobile gaming on your TV, it’s essential to understand some potential pitfalls:

1. Latency Issues

One of the most prominent issues with wireless connections, particularly with screen mirroring and casting, is latency. This delay between your phone’s actions and what you see on the TV can be frustrating in competitive gaming situations.

2. Display Quality

Quality can vary significantly depending on the method you choose. HDMI typically provides the best video quality, while wireless methods may offer a lower resolution.

3. App Compatibility

Not all mobile games support casting or mirroring. Check if your preferred games are compatible with your method before diving in.

4. Battery Consumption

Mirroring or casting can drain your phone’s battery rapidly. It’s advisable to keep your phone connected to a charger while gaming.

How do I connect my phone to my TV?

To connect your phone to your TV, you can use several methods depending on your TV setup. One of the simplest ways is to use screen mirroring, which allows your phone to cast its screen to the TV. This feature is generally found in the settings menu of both your TV and smartphone. For Android devices, you might look for ‘Cast’ or ‘Smart View,’ while iPhone users will need to use ‘AirPlay.’

If you prefer a wired connection, you can use an HDMI cable. For many phones, you may also need an HDMI adapter that suits your device’s charging port. Connect one end of the cable to your phone and the other to the TV, then switch the input source on your TV to the corresponding HDMI output.
